Transaction 59afabe3bb42f7ca540e265d76be15af524f04d52b9e30bde3aedbeb391e4aed
1 Input
1 Output
-
59afabe3bb42f7ca540e265d76be15af524f04d52b9e30bde3aedbeb391e4aed:0
- value
- 100225000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 497eb21d1f84bec8a48d1dd3f174f120328a12a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17hc6ynp5AVzQYkMeJM4iB4DeazeyMgA58